    Ethanol Fireplaces

    The installation of ethanol fireplaces is more flexible since they don't require a chimney. They also burn cleanly which reduces the risk of chimney fires and other dangerous gasses.

    flamme-60-152cm-castello-slim-frame-recessed-media-wall-inset-electric-fireplace-with-multi-flame-colours-750w-1500w-2500.jpgIf you adhere to some basic safety guidelines, freestanding bioethanol fireplaces are likely to be no more dangerous than any other kind of home fire. There are a few things to remember.

    Clean the burn

    When compared to traditional fireplaces that burn gas or wood, ethanol fires are extremely safe to use and require only minimal ventilation. Bioethanol fires burn liquid ethanol fuel which doesn't produce smoke, soot, or ash. This makes them perfect for small areas, where it can be difficult to install the chimney or fireplace.

    Bioethanol fireplaces also produce an immense amount of convection heat, which circulates across the space. This means that the entire area will be heated instead of just the area closest to the flames. The absence of a chimney means that heat won't escape to the air outside.

    bioethanol fire (please click the following website) fireplaces release only CO2 and water vapour when they burn. This is unlike traditional fireplaces, which emit lots of smoke, and can create an unpleasant odor in your home. This makes them very safe for your home and the environment.

    In addition they are also easy to maintain and can be installed in any room in your office or home. Ethanol fireplaces are simple to use and can be turned on and off with an easy switch. They are also energy efficient and consume a fraction of what traditional fireplaces can do to heat your house.

    If you decide to purchase an ethanol-based biofuel fire, you must to purchase high quality fuel. Make sure you're using the correct fuel for your stove and keep it topped up with fresh ethanol fuel. To prevent harm to your fireplace, don't add water to the tank, or try to extinguish it with a blower. This could cause serious injury.

    Give at least 20 minutes after the flame has gone out. After that, you can close the lid of your burner using the included damper tool in a swift, yet considerate manner. This will strip the fuel of oxygen, thereby putting out the fire. It is not recommended to use water or blow out the flame because it could cause damage to your fireplace.

    Use it in a safe manner

    Ethanol Fireplaces are a simple and safe way to provide warmth to your home, without the requirement for chimney or flue. Bioethanol is the fuel used, which is not flammable and produces less CO2 than other fuels. The fireplace does not emit smoke, which makes it ideal for those who are sensitive to allergens.

    Like all devices that produce fire, ethanol fireplaces are dangerous if they are not used in a safe manner. This is particularly applicable to setting up, refuelling lighting and managing the flames. The primary safety concern is to ensure that only the correct amount of fuel is used. Over-using the recommended amount could cause the fire spread out and catch objects in flames.

    Keep a safe distance from the flame while it's burning. The fireplace should be set in a room that is well ventilated and it's a good idea to keep pets and children away from the flame too. In addition, it's best to shut the door when the fireplace is lit and never place ornaments or other flammable items on top of the fireplace at any moment.

    In the event of an emergency it is essential to keep a fire extinguisher in class B in close proximity to the fireplace. It's important to follow the manufacturer's guidelines for placing the fireplace and refuelling. Certain ethanol fireplaces, for example, require that they are kept at a certain distance from combustible items. Others might require that they be operated only in large rooms with adequate fresh air circulation.

    When you are looking to purchase an ethanol fireplace, make sure you go to one that is certified by UL. This certification guarantees that the product has been thoroughly tested and is compliant with all applicable safety standards. A brand that offers a warranty extension will give you peace of peace of mind in the event a product malfunction.

    A UL-certified bioethanol fireplace will have a stainless steel burner box that is filled with biofuel and set to alight. It is possible to expect about 3.5 hours of heat from 1 one litre of fuel.
